CHERRY PISTACHIO COOKIES
Dried cherries, crunchy nuts, bits of orange, white chocolate-there's a lot to love in this cookie! It's very different from any I've had before. -Kathy Harding, Richmond, Missouri

Steps:
- In a large bowl, cream butter and confectioners' sugar until light and fluffy. Beat in egg and orange zest. In another bowl, whisk flour, baking soda and cream of tartar; gradually beat into creamed mixture. Stir in cherries and pistachios., Divide dough in half ; shape each into an 11-in.-long roll. Wrap in plastic; refrigerate at least 2 hours or until firm., Preheat oven to 375°. Unwrap and cut dough crosswise into 1/2-in. slices. Place 2 in. apart on ungreased baking sheets. Bake 8-10 minutes or until edges are light golden brown. Remove from pans to wire racks to cool completely. Frost cookies with melted white chocolate; let stand until set., To Make Ahead: Dough can be made 2 days in advance. Wrap in plastic and place in a resealable bag. Store in the refrigerator., Freeze option: Place wrapped rolls in a resealable plastic freezer bag and freeze. To use, unwrap frozen logs and cut into slices. If necessary, let dough stand 15 minutes at room temperature before cutting. Bake as directed, increasing time by 1-2 minutes. Decorate as directed.

CHERRY PISTACHIO SLICE & BAKE COOKIES
Adapted from Yankee magazine. I think these cookies are just lovely and am hoping to make them this year. The pistachios provide lovely green specks of color, so although they would still taste nice with a different nut, you would lose the green-red holiday effect if you substitute. Sanding sugar is the coarse, sparkly sugar that is used to decorate cookies - unlike ordinary sugar, the crystals will stay whole and look like clear sparkly sprinkles on the cookie edges (you can also use red or green). Plan ahead as the dough must chill overnight.

Steps:
- Cream butter, granulated sugar, and salt using a mixer.
- Add egg yolk (cover and chill your egg white for later in the recipe) and beat well.
- Add flour and nuts and stir with a wooden spoon (the mixer would toughen the dough) until blended.
- Using your hands or wooden spoon, blend in the cherries- the dough will be firm and this will be tricky, which is why your clean hands might be best for this.
- Divide dough into halves, roll each into a log and wrap in wax paper, sealing ends; chill overnight or at least 8 hours.
- Preheat oven to 350 F, line cookie sheets with parchment paper or grease lightly.
- Lay out a pan big enough to roll your cookie logs around in and sprinkle the sanding sugar in the pan.
- Open up one of your dough logs and lightly brush with egg white, then roll the log in the sugar to coat.
- Place on a cutting board and slice into 1/2" rounds.
- Bake cookies 12-15 minutes per batch, cooling on racks when done.

CHERRY PISTACHIO PINWHEEL COOKIES
Jeff Mauro rolls cherries and pistachios into his dough before covering the cookie logs with sprinkles. Slice and bake the pinwheels after a night in the fridge.

Steps:
- Put the cherries, pistachios and brown sugar in a food processor and pulse until a fine crumb forms (take care not to over process or the filling will clump together). Set aside.
- Put the butter and granulated sugar in the bowl of a stand mixer fitted with a paddle attachment and beat on medium-high until light and fluffy, about 2 minutes. Add the eggs, baking powder and salt and beat for another minute. Lower the speed to medium and add the flour, 1/2 cup at a time; beat until smooth. Cover and place in the fridge to chill, about 1 hour.
- Divide dough the in half and flatten each into squares. Put one portion of dough in between two 12-by-12-inch sheets of parchment paper dusted with flour. Roll out into a 1/8-inch-thick square. Remove the top parchment sheet and sprinkle half of the cherry-pistachio filling evenly across the dough. Pat into an even layer. Tightly roll into one large log (using the parchment to help you). Trim the ends and then roll the exterior in a mixture of sprinkles to coat. Repeat with the remaining dough, filling and sprinkles. Tightly cover in fresh parchment and refrigerate overnight (preferred) or at least 4 hours, until the dough is firm.
-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F and line 2 baking sheets with parchment or a silicone baking mat.
- Remove and uncover the dough logs and slice with a very sharp knife into 1/4-inch-thick pinwheels. Arrange about 1 inch apart on the prepared baking sheets. Bake until slightly golden, 8 to 10 minutes. Let the cookies cool on a wire rack. Store for up to 3 days in an airtight container, or freeze cookies for future use, up to 2 weeks.
